How does probability relate to genetics?

Respuesta :

cutelion918
cutelion918 cutelion918
  • 24-08-2016
Given the genotypes of both parents you can put the alleles into a punnet square. Probablilty relates to the chance of obtaining a set of homozygous dominant/recessive or a heterozygous phenotype after you can see all the possible combinations and how often they appear on the punnet square.
